    If it weren't for the fact the devs put tons of time and work into implementing these new races, I'd heavily suggest they cut them out. If adding new content causes this much upset, why do it at all?

    The devs have explained exactly why there are no male Viera or female Hrothgar, and it was mainly due to both technical and design reasons. Technical because they are building, and still fixing, off of the original 1.0. 2.0 isn't a completely built from the ground up game, it still uses a lot of parts from 1.0, and unfortunately they've met with some technical limitations. Design being the fact there are over 10k equipable items. For every new race and gender, 10k items roughly have to be modified. The biggest decider in all of this as well, is that they wanted both a new humanesk race, and a bestial race. They know that they can only do 2 different characters, so a gender-lock was the only way they could introduce new races and try to make everyone happy. However, it seems this backfired big time on SE.
